This document outlines potential enhancements to the InnerPod session recording and history features.
Current State: Only start and end times are shown
Enhancement: Calculate and display session duration
Implementation:
// In lib/widgets/history.dart
_sessions = jsonList.map((item) {
final start = DateTime.parse(item['start']);
final end = DateTime.parse(item['end']);
final duration = end.difference(start);
return {
'date': DateFormat('yyyy-MM-dd').format(start),
'start': DateFormat('HH:mm:ss').format(start),
'end': DateFormat('HH:mm:ss').format(end),
'duration': '${duration.inMinutes} min ${duration.inSeconds % 60} sec',
};
}).toList();
// Add duration column to DataTable
DataColumn(label: Text('Duration')),
// ...
DataCell(Text(session['duration']!)),Effort: 🟢 Low (30 minutes)

Current State: No summary statistics
Enhancement: Show total meditation time, session count, average duration
Implementation:
// In lib/widgets/history.dart
Widget _buildStatistics() {
if (_sessions.isEmpty) return SizedBox.shrink();
int totalMinutes = 0;
for (var session in _sessions) {
final start = DateTime.parse(session['start']);
final end = DateTime.parse(session['end']);
totalMinutes += end.difference(start).inMinutes;
}
final avgMinutes = totalMinutes ~/ _sessions.length;
return Card(
child: Padding(
padding: EdgeInsets.all(16),
child: Column(
children: [
Text('Total Sessions: ${_sessions.length}'),
Text('Total Time: ${totalMinutes ~/ 60}h ${totalMinutes % 60}m'),
Text('Average Duration: $avgMinutes minutes'),
],
),
),
);
}Effort: 🟡 Medium (2 hours)

Enhancement: Export session history to CSV file
Implementation:
// In lib/widgets/history.dart
import 'package:csv/csv.dart';
import 'package:path_provider/path_provider.dart';
import 'dart:io';
Future<void> _exportToCSV() async {
List<List<dynamic>> rows = [
['Date', 'Start Time', 'End Time', 'Duration', 'Type'],
];
for (var session in _sessions) {
rows.add([
session['date'],
session['start'],
session['end'],
session['duration'],
session['type'] ?? 'start',
]);
}
String csv = const ListToCsvConverter().convert(rows);
final directory = await getApplicationDocumentsDirectory();
final path = '${directory.path}/innerpod_sessions.csv';
final file = File(path);
await file.writeAsString(csv);
// Show success message
ScaffoldMessenger.of(context).showSnackBar(
SnackBar(content: Text('Exported to $path')),
);
}Dependencies to Add:
dependencies:
csv: ^6.0.0
path_provider: ^2.1.0Effort: 🟡 Medium (3-4 hours)

Enhancement: Queue sessions when offline, sync when connection restored
Architecture:
┌─────────────────────────────────────┐
│ Session Completes │
└──────────────┬──────────────────────┘
│
▼
┌─────────────────────────────────────┐
│ Check Internet Connection │
└──────────────┬──────────────────────┘
│
┌───────┴────────┐
▼ ▼
┌─────────────┐ ┌─────────────────┐
│ Online │ │ Offline │
│ Save to │ │ Save to Local │
│ Pod │ │ Queue │
└─────────────┘ └────────┬────────┘
│
▼
┌─────────────────┐
│ Connection │
│ Restored │
└────────┬────────┘
│
▼
┌─────────────────┐
│ Sync Queue │
│ to Pod │
└─────────────────┘
Implementation:
// lib/services/session_sync_service.dart
import 'package:connectivity_plus/connectivity_plus.dart';
import 'package:shared_preferences/shared_preferences.dart';
class SessionSyncService {
static const String _queueKey = 'session_queue';
static Future<void> saveSession(Map<String, String> session) async {
final connectivity = await Connectivity().checkConnectivity();
if (connectivity != ConnectivityResult.none) {
// Online: Save directly to Pod
await _saveToPod(session);
} else {
// Offline: Add to queue
await _addToQueue(session);
}
}
static Future<void> syncQueue() async {
final prefs = await SharedPreferences.getInstance();
final queueJson = prefs.getString(_queueKey);
if (queueJson == null) return;
List<dynamic> queue = jsonDecode(queueJson);
for (var session in queue) {
try {
await _saveToPod(session);
} catch (e) {
debugPrint('Failed to sync session: $e');
return; // Stop syncing if one fails
}
}
// Clear queue after successful sync
await prefs.remove(_queueKey);
}
static Future<void> _saveToPod(Map<String, dynamic> session) async {
String? content = await readPod('sessions.json');
List<dynamic> sessions = [];
if (content != null && content.isNotEmpty) {
sessions = jsonDecode(content);
}
sessions.add(session);
await writePod('sessions.json', jsonEncode(sessions));
}
static Future<void> _addToQueue(Map<String, dynamic> session) async {
final prefs = await SharedPreferences.getInstance();
final queueJson = prefs.getString(_queueKey);
List<dynamic> queue = [];
if (queueJson != null) {
queue = jsonDecode(queueJson);
}
queue.add(session);
await prefs.setString(_queueKey, jsonEncode(queue));
}
}Dependencies:
dependencies:
connectivity_plus: ^5.0.0
shared_preferences: ^2.2.0Effort: 🔴 High (12-16 hours)
Enhancement: Daily notifications to remind users to meditate
Features:
- Customizable reminder time
- Multiple reminders per day
- Smart reminders (skip if already meditated)
- Motivational quotes in notifications
Implementation:
// lib/services/notification_service.dart
import 'package:flutter_local_notifications/flutter_local_notifications.dart';
class NotificationService {
static final FlutterLocalNotificationsPlugin _notifications =
FlutterLocalNotificationsPlugin();
static Future<void> initialize() async {
const androidSettings = AndroidInitializationSettings('@mipmap/ic_launcher');
const iosSettings = DarwinInitializationSettings();
const settings = InitializationSettings(
android: androidSettings,
iOS: iosSettings,
);
await _notifications.initialize(settings);
}
static Future<void> scheduleDailyReminder({
required int hour,
required int minute,
}) async {
await _notifications.zonedSchedule(
0,
'Time to Meditate',
'Take a moment for your inner peace 🧘',
_nextInstanceOfTime(hour, minute),
const NotificationDetails(
android: AndroidNotificationDetails(
'meditation_reminder',
'Meditation Reminders',
channelDescription: 'Daily meditation reminders',
importance: Importance.high,
),
),
androidScheduleMode: AndroidScheduleMode.exactAllowWhileIdle,
uiLocalNotificationDateInterpretation:
UILocalNotificationDateInterpretation.absoluteTime,
matchDateTimeComponents: DateTimeComponents.time,
);
}
static tz.TZDateTime _nextInstanceOfTime(int hour, int minute) {
final now = tz.TZDateTime.now(tz.local);
var scheduledDate = tz.TZDateTime(
tz.local,
now.year,
now.month,
now.day,
hour,
minute,
);
if (scheduledDate.isBefore(now)) {
scheduledDate = scheduledDate.add(const Duration(days: 1));
}
return scheduledDate;
}
}Dependencies:
dependencies:
flutter_local_notifications: ^16.0.0
timezone: ^0.9.0Effort: 🔴 High (10-14 hours)
